Add history sync, resolves #13 (#31)
* Add encryption * Add login and register command * Add count endpoint * Write initial sync push * Add single sync command Confirmed working for one client only * Automatically sync on a configurable frequency * Add key command, key arg to login * Only load session if it exists * Use sync and history timestamps for download * Bind other key code Seems like some systems have this code for up arrow? I'm not sure why, and it's not an easy one to google. * Simplify upload * Try and fix download sync loop * Change sync order to avoid uploading what we just downloaded * Multiline import fix * Fix time parsing * Fix importing history with no time * Add hostname to sync * Use hostname to filter sync * Fixes * Add binding * Stuff from yesterday * Set cursor modes * Make clippy happy * Bump version
